Udamina Thomson, 1868 Udamina Thomson, 1868: 124; Lacordaire, 1872: 913; Martins & Galileo, 1989: 120. Type-species: Udamina leprieurii Thomson, 1868 (monotypy). Paraphaula Fuchs, 1963: 13; Martins, 1984: 308; Martins & Galileo: 1998: 13 (rev.), syn. nov. Fuchs (1963) described Paraphaula in the tribe Aerenicini, and the genus remained not identified by Martins (1984) and Martins & Galileo (1989). Herbert Schmid from Vienna kindly sent the photograph of the holotype of Paraphaula porosa Fuchs, allowing us to propose the present synonymy. It seems impossible to identify a genus described in an erroneus tribe, and if Paraphaula was described in Forsteriini and rather than in Aerenicini undoubtly, the identification would be possible.
Published as part of Monné, Miguel A. & R, Juan Pablo Botero, 2011, Synonymical notes on Neotropical Cerambycidae (Insecta, Coleoptera), pp. 64-68 in Zootaxa 2928 on page 67, DOI: 10.5281/zenodo.278005
